Al Akhdoud (Home)
- Fathi Al-Jabal’s pragmatic approach since his March 2026 appointment as Al Akhdoud boss has seen his side adopt a more three-at-the-back setup, looking to remain compact and protect their defence before hitting on the counter.
- The hosts' home record in the league stands at 3 wins, 3 draws and 9 losses from 15 matches.
- They’ve scored just 1.00 goals per game at home, and Saeed Al-Rubaie is their top scorer in the league with four from 19 appearances.
Al-Ettifaq Dammam (Away)
- Al-Ettifaq Dammam boss Saad Al-Shehri has moulded the club into a progressive, possession-based team in his time at the helm since January 2025.
- The visitors play an offensive-minded style of soccer, with a midfield overload and coordinated pressing allowing their talented players to flourish in the final third.
- Al-Ettifaq Dammam sit 7th in the Profesional League 2025-2026 table, having collected 42 points from their first 29 matches of the campaign.
- The visitors are a well-balanced unit, with midfielder Georginio Wijnaldum netting 14 goals in 28 league appearances in 2025-2026.
- Khalid Al Ghannam has chipped in with two goals in their last five, providing Al-Ettifaq’s talisman with some much-needed support in front of goal.
Head-to-Head
- Al-Ettifaq Dammam won the reverse fixture 2-0 at home three months ago.
- Al-Ettifaq Dammam have scored an average of 1.0 goal per game in head-to-head clashes, while Al Akhdoud have scored 0.5 per game in those meetings.
